The Reds will pay the fee to the Germans for the winger.

Liverpool have reached an agreement with Bayer Leverkusen for Florian Wirtz as the Reds will pay them 100 million pounds + 16 million additional in bonuses for their star.

The add-ons will be paid for almost certainly by the Premier League giants as they will chase silverware with the young German star in their squad.

The transfer will beat Chelsea’s 115 million pounds to Brighton for Moises Caicedo and will become the new record for the highest transfer fee paid by a British team. Florian will become just the 10th player in history to be transferred for a fee of over 100 million pounds as he joins the company of stars such as Neymar, Kylian Mbappe, and Jude Bellingham.

The young German star, who is still only 22 years old, was wanted by all the biggest teams in Europe, such as Real Madrid, PSG, and Man City. However, the Reds won him with their project and made him the key footballer in the future of the squad. Even Bayern Munich were unable to compete with Liverpool and the money that the EPL giants could offer to Leverkusen.
